Output f58d61ede91c8cbeab6c96ca1e60bc70d40abe31f87ea5d15e8694f3917cb50b:0

value
35896331
script pubkey
OP_0 OP_PUSHBYTES_20 8d6d30b38038dc632c8380b72ff064830e4a3151
address
bc1q34knpvuq8rwxxtyrszmjlurysv8y5v230x6pkx
transaction
f58d61ede91c8cbeab6c96ca1e60bc70d40abe31f87ea5d15e8694f3917cb50b
spent
true